London to New York ‘air hall’ might be in place by November

US officers are reviving stalled talks about creating an “air hall” between London and New York, it was reported on Saturday, with hope {that a} system might be in place in time for Thanksgiving.

The American vacation, on November 26 this 12 months, often sees big numbers of individuals flying internationally and domestically, to go to kinfolk and reap the benefits of days off work.

British and US authorities had mentioned the potential of an air hall between London and New York earlier this 12 months, however the talks now have added urgency as Thanksgiving and Christmas draw nearer.

The Transportation Division, Division of Homeland Safety and different businesses are trying as soon as once more to determine secure journey corridors between the US and worldwide locations, the Wall Road Journal reported.

Establishing these routes would require vacationers to be examined for Covid-19 earlier than their flight and once more upon arrival, permitting them to keep away from prolonged quarantines at their locations.

Covid assessments might be launched at airports in London and New York to create an ‘air hall’(Getty)

Talks are additionally being held with German officers, the paper mentioned.

A Homeland Safety official mentioned the company’s work to “safely encourage trans-Atlantic journey whereas mitigating public well being dangers” was in its early phases.

At the moment, Americans touring to the UK should quarantine for 14 days and can’t journey to many of the European Union.

Travellers from the UK and Europe usually are not allowed into america, until they’re US residents or everlasting residents.

On 1 October, Tampa airport in Florida grew to become the primary within the US to promote Covid assessments to passengers who needed to have one.

Earlier than boarding or after touchdown, vacationers can get a $57 (£44) antigen check with an 88 per cent accuracy that provides outcomes inside 15 minutes, or a $125 (£96) polymerase chain response (PCR) check that has 95 per cent accuracy however takes 48 hours to ship outcomes. Ticketed travellers can go to the airport within the days main as much as their flight for the PCR check.

Departing passengers who come up constructive for the antigen check can be suggested to not board.

The assessments usually are not obligatory.

Below the plans for the New York-London air hall, nevertheless, the assessments can be necessary earlier than boarding and the fee, as but unspecified, would seemingly be borne by the passenger.

John Holland-Kaye, CEO of Heathrow, mentioned on 30 September that progress was being made and he hoped to have flights “up and operating” by the top of November.

“We’ve heard from the Prime Minister that he hopes to go to a trial within the second half of October,” he mentioned. 

“I might like to have a New York-London pilot up and operating by Thanksgiving. That appears completely possible.”
